openssl/ssl
Trevor 9cd50f738f Cleanup of custom extension stuff.
serverinfo rejects non-empty extensions.

Omit extension if no relevant serverinfo data.

Improve error-handling in serverinfo callback.

Cosmetic cleanups.

s_client documentation.

s_server documentation.

SSL_CTX_serverinfo documentation.

Cleaup -1 and NULL callback handling for custom extensions, add tests.

Cleanup ssl_rsa.c serverinfo code.

Whitespace cleanup.

Improve comments in ssl.h for serverinfo.

Whitespace.

Cosmetic cleanup.

Reject non-zero-len serverinfo extensions.

Whitespace.

Make it build.
2013-06-18 16:13:08 +01:00
..
.cvsignore
bio_ssl.c
d1_both.c Enable TLS 1.2 ciphers in DTLS 1.2. 2013-03-28 14:14:27 +00:00
d1_clnt.c Dual DTLS version methods. 2013-04-09 14:02:48 +01:00
d1_enc.c
d1_lib.c Dual DTLS version methods. 2013-04-09 14:02:48 +01:00
d1_meth.c Dual DTLS version methods. 2013-04-09 14:02:48 +01:00
d1_pkt.c Dual DTLS version methods. 2013-04-09 14:02:48 +01:00
d1_srtp.c
d1_srvr.c Suite B support for DTLS 1.2 2013-04-09 16:49:13 +01:00
dtls1.h Dual DTLS version methods. 2013-04-09 14:02:48 +01:00
install-ssl.com
kssl_lcl.h
kssl.c
kssl.h
Makefile
s2_clnt.c
s2_enc.c
s2_lib.c
s2_meth.c
s2_pkt.c
s2_srvr.c
s3_both.c
s3_cbc.c Use enc_flags when deciding protocol variations. 2013-03-18 15:03:58 +00:00
s3_clnt.c Suite B support for DTLS 1.2 2013-04-09 16:49:13 +01:00
s3_enc.c
s3_lib.c Add support for arbitrary TLS extensions. 2013-06-12 17:01:13 +01:00
s3_meth.c
s3_pkt.c Limit the number of empty records that will be processed consecutively 2013-06-13 17:10:52 +01:00
s3_srvr.c This change alters the processing of invalid, RSA pre-master secrets so 2013-06-13 16:58:45 +01:00
s23_clnt.c
s23_lib.c
s23_meth.c
s23_pkt.c
s23_srvr.c
srtp.h
ssl2.h
ssl3.h Add support for arbitrary TLS extensions. 2013-06-12 17:01:13 +01:00
ssl23.h
ssl_algs.c Add AES-SHA256 stitch. 2013-05-13 22:49:58 +02:00
ssl_asn1.c
ssl_cert.c Add support for arbitrary TLS extensions. 2013-06-12 17:01:13 +01:00
ssl_ciph.c Add AES-SHA256 stitch. 2013-05-13 22:49:58 +02:00
ssl_conf.c
ssl_err2.c
ssl_err.c Limit the number of empty records that will be processed consecutively 2013-06-13 17:10:52 +01:00
ssl_lib.c Add support for arbitrary TLS extensions. 2013-06-12 17:01:13 +01:00
ssl_locl.h Add support for arbitrary TLS extensions. 2013-06-12 17:01:13 +01:00
ssl_rsa.c Cleanup of custom extension stuff. 2013-06-18 16:13:08 +01:00
ssl_sess.c Provisional DTLS 1.2 support. 2013-03-26 15:16:41 +00:00
ssl_stat.c
ssl_task.c
ssl_txt.c Provisional DTLS 1.2 support. 2013-03-26 15:16:41 +00:00
ssl-lib.com
ssl.h Cleanup of custom extension stuff. 2013-06-18 16:13:08 +01:00
ssltest.c Cleanup of custom extension stuff. 2013-06-18 16:13:08 +01:00
t1_clnt.c Use appropriate versions of SSL3_ENC_METHOD 2013-03-18 14:53:59 +00:00
t1_enc.c Enable TLS 1.2 ciphers in DTLS 1.2. 2013-03-28 14:14:27 +00:00
t1_lib.c Cleanup of custom extension stuff. 2013-06-18 16:13:08 +01:00
t1_meth.c Use appropriate versions of SSL3_ENC_METHOD 2013-03-18 14:53:59 +00:00
t1_reneg.c
t1_srvr.c Use appropriate versions of SSL3_ENC_METHOD 2013-03-18 14:53:59 +00:00
t1_trce.c Provisional DTLS 1.2 support. 2013-03-26 15:16:41 +00:00
tls1.h
tls_srp.c